如何判断Git pull是否成功
-
判断Git pull命令是否成功主要有以下几个方面的参考标准:
1. 返回值:在执行git pull命令后,可以通过查看返回值来判断是否成功。通常情况下,如果返回值为0,则表示成功;如果返回值为非0,则表示失败。
2. 输出信息:执行git pull命令后,会有相应的输出信息显示在命令行窗口中。如果输出信息中显示有类似”Already up to date.”的字样,表示当前分支已经是最新的,也就是没有新的更新需要拉取,可以认为pull命令成功执行;如果输出信息中显示有类似”Merge made by the ‘recursive’ strategy”的字样,表示有新的更新合并到本地分支,也可以认为pull命令成功执行。
3. 冲突提示:有时候在执行git pull命令时,可能会遇到冲突的情况,这时会有相应的提示信息显示在命令行窗口中。如果出现冲突提示,并且需要手动解决冲突后才能完成pull操作,说明pull命令执行失败;如果没有出现冲突提示,直接完成了pull操作,可以认为pull命令成功执行。
总的来说,判断Git pull命令是否成功可以从返回值、输出信息和冲突提示这几个方面来综合考虑。如果返回值为0,输出信息显示已经是最新的或有新的更新合并到本地分支,并且没有冲突提示,可以认定pull命令执行成功。
2年前 -
判断Git pull是否成功有多种方法,以下是常用的五种方式:
1. 查看命令行输出:在执行Git pull命令后,命令行会输出相关信息。如果Git pull成功,输出会显示更新了哪些文件,并给出一些其他的提示信息。如果Git pull遇到错误或失败,命令行会显示错误相关的信息。因此,你可以简单地通过查看命令行输出来判断Git pull是否成功。
2. 查看工作区状态:可以使用Git status命令来查看工作区的状态。如果Git pull成功,工作区的状态应该是干净的,没有任何未提交的变更。如果Git pull失败,可能会出现未合并的分支或冲突等问题,工作区的状态会显示相关的提示信息。
3. 查看远程分支信息:可以使用Git branch -r命令来查看远程分支的信息。如果Git pull成功,远程分支的信息应该是最新的。如果Git pull失败,远程分支的信息可能是旧的或不一致的。
4. 查看日志信息:可以使用Git log命令来查看最近的提交日志信息。如果Git pull成功,应该有新的提交记录。如果Git pull失败,日志信息可能没有更新或者存在合并冲突的记录。
5. 检查文件更新时间:可以通过检查文件的更新时间来判断Git pull是否成功。在Git pull成功后,被更新的文件的时间戳将会被更新为最新的时间。可以使用操作系统的文件管理工具或命令来查看文件的更新时间。
以上是常用的判断Git pull是否成功的方法,根据不同的情况选择合适的方式进行判断。
2年前 -
判断Git pull是否成功主要可以通过以下几种方法来进行判断:
1. 查看返回信息:在执行Git pull命令后,终端会显示一些相关的返回信息,包括执行过程中的一些提示信息,例如更新了哪些文件、有冲突的文件等。可以通过查看终端返回的信息,判断Git pull是否成功。
2. 查看代码库状态:执行Git pull命令后,可以使用Git status命令来查看代码库的当前状态。如果Git pull成功,则代码库的状态应该是干净的,即没有未提交的更改。如果代码库有未提交的更改,则说明Git pull可能存在问题。
3. 查看日志信息:Git pull命令会更新本地代码库,并将更新的日志信息记录在日志中。可以通过执行Git log命令来查看代码库的更新历史。如果Git pull成功,应该能够看到最近一次的更新记录。
4. 查看分支信息:如果在Git pull命令中指定了分支,可以使用Git branch命令来查看当前分支的信息。如果Git pull成功,当前分支应该是最新的。
5. 查看文件变动:使用Git diff命令可以比较当前代码库和上次提交的版本之间的差异。如果Git pull成功,应该没有任何差异。
需要注意的是,以上方法仅用于初步判断Git pull是否成功。如果仍有疑问,建议仔细查看终端输出以及日志信息,并与团队其他成员进行沟通,确保Git pull成功并同步了最新的代码。此外,也可以使用Git的一些高级功能来进行更详细的分析和判断,例如使用Git reflog命令查看引用日志、使用Git stash命令保存工作进度等。
2年前